The Whistle
(1921) American
B&W : Six reels / 5359 feet
Directed by Lambert Hillyer

Cast: William S. Hart, Myrtle Stedman, Frank Brownlee, Georgie Stone, Will Jim Hatton, Richard Headrick, Robert Kortman

The William S. Hart Company production; distributed by Paramount Pictures Corporation [Artcraft Pictures]. / Scenario by Lambert Hillyer, from a screen story by May Wilmoth and Olin Lyman. Art direction by J.C. Hoffner. Cinematography by Joe August (Joseph H. August). Art titles (intertitles artwork) by Harry Barndollar. / © 4 February 1921 by The William S. Hart Company. Premiered 27 March 1921 in New York, New York. Released 23 April 1921. / Standard 35mm spherical 1.37:1 format.

Drama.

Survival Status: Print exists in the Library of Congress film archive.

Listing updated: 3 April 2009.

References: Everson-American p. 182a; Koszarski-Hart pp. xx, 131-133; Limbacher-Feature p. 274.
